Ingredients
- Fettuccine pasta
- Sirloin or ribeye steak
- Cajun seasoning
- Heavy cream
- Parmesan cheese
- Garlic
- Olive oil
- Fresh parsley
Instructions
- Cook fettuccine in salted boiling water until al dente; reserve some pasta water before draining.
- Sear seasoned steak in olive oil over medium-high heat until browned to your liking. Let rest.
- In the same skillet, sauté minced garlic until fragrant, then stir in heavy cream.
- Whisk in grated Parmesan cheese until smooth; adjust seasoning with more Cajun spices if needed.
- Slice the rested steak thinly and combine with the sauce and fettuccine, adding reserved pasta water for desired consistency.
- Serve hot, garnished with fresh parsley.
